Combine 1/4 cup warmed milk with yeast and honey. Set aside until foamy (about 5 minutes).
Place the butter in small saucepan over medium heat. Once melted, the butter will begin to foam. Keep stirring until the butter begins to turn a light amber color. The foam will subside and you will have little brown specks (milk solids) at the bottom of the pan.
In a large bowl combine egg, yeast mixture, sage and milk.
Add 2 and 1/2 cup flour and salt. Mix to combine adding in additional flour to make dough workable.
Knead mixture for 7-10 minutes. Shape into a ball, place back into bowl, and let rise for an hour, until doubled.
Place dough onto counter and divide into 12 sections (roughly 2.5 oz each). Shape into a ball and place on a baking sheet to rise four about another hour.
Bake at 350 for 25-30 minutes. Top with a little more butter if desired
